大数据开发,必备技能与实战指南
云云软件开发2025-09-26阅读(602)
大数据开发是一项复杂而多方面的任务,它涉及到多个技术和工具的使用。了解和掌握Hadoop生态系统的核心组件是至关重要的。这包括HDFS(分布式文件系统)和MapReduce(数据处理框架),它们为大规模数据的存储和处理提供了基础。,,熟悉Spark等流处理框架对于实时数据分析至关重要。这些技术能够高效地处理大量数据流,从而实现实时的业务洞察和分析。,,NoSQL数据库如MongoDB和Cassandra在处理非结构化数据时表现出色。它们能够灵活地适应不同类型的数据结构,并提供高性能的数据查询能力。,,掌握Python或Java等编程语言以及相关库(如Pandas、NumPy等)对于进行数据处理和分析也是必不可少的。这些工具可以帮助开发者更有效地操作和分析复杂数据集。,,要成为一名优秀的大数据开发人员,需要具备扎实的计算机科学基础知识,同时还要不断学习和更新技能以应对快速变化的技术环境。
在当今科技迅猛发展的时代,大数据已成为推动各行业创新与变革的核心驱动力,面对这一充满机遇与挑战的新时代,掌握大数据开发技能成为了众多人的职业目标,在大数据开发的道路上,究竟需要掌握哪些关键的技能呢?本文将为你详细解答。
扎实的编程基础是大数据开发的基石,无论是Python、Java还是C++等主流编程语言,熟练掌握其中的一种或多种都是必不可少的,这些语言不仅能帮助我们进行数据处理和分析,还能让我们深入理解算法和数据结构,为后续深入学习奠定坚实基础。
对数据库技术的深入了解同样是不可或缺的,SQL作为关系型数据库的标准查询语言,其重要性不言而喻;而NoSQL数据库如MongoDB、Redis等的出现则为大数据处理提供了更多可能性,了解各类数据库的特点和应用场景,并能够灵活运用它们进行数据存储与管理,是大数据开发者必须具备的一项核心能力。
强大的数据分析能力也至关重要,大数据的价值在于通过对海量数据的分析与挖掘,揭示隐藏其中的规律和趋势,从而为企业决策提供有力支持,为此,我们需要具备深厚的统计学知识以及高超的数据分析技巧,能够从浩瀚的数据海洋中提炼出有价值的见解,并通过图表等形式直观地展示出来。
优秀的团队合作能力和出色的沟通表达能力同样不容忽视,在大规模的数据工程项目中,往往需要跨部门、跨团队的紧密协作,学会与他人有效沟通与合作、共同分享资源与创意,以及清晰明确地表达个人观点与需求,都是项目成功的关键要素。
若想成为一位卓越的大数据工程师,就必须持续不断地学习和提升自我各方面的能力,唯有拥有牢固的技术根基与实践积累,方能在这场激烈的竞争中立于不败之地,最终实现个人的职业理想,让我们一起携手共进,迎接未来的无限可能吧!
热门标签: #大数据开发 #实战指南